S4/S5 tailight project in progress, the degree of shading can be adjusted
of course
S4 lights: were crackly and ugly, now sanded, epoxy coated, sanded and painted
lenses were scrathed and hazy, now shaded, sanded and polished
S5 lights were hazy and the housing had some deep
scrathces in them, now sanded, clearcoated and shaded
keep in mind the flash bounced off the reflector on the S5 light
